How should I choose between different scarf weights in this collection?
Use fabric and volume as your guide. Lightweight wool or silk works with tailoring and indoor wear, while thicker knits and cashmere blends suit colder weather or outerwear. If you prefer a cleaner line, go for narrower or less fringed styles; oversized or brushed finishes add more texture and coverage.
What should I look for in sunglasses fit and shape?
Start with frame width and how the arms sit against your temples so the glasses feel secure without pressure. Cat-eye and butterfly shapes often complement sharper tailoring and dresses, while rectangular or geometric frames pair well with more minimal wardrobes. If you’re between styles, choose the frame that sits comfortably on your nose and doesn’t touch your cheeks when you smile.
How do I style hats and caps with structured outerwear?
Balance proportions and textures. A curved-brim cap or clean beanie works well with oversized coats and quilted jackets, while more sculpted hats pair easily with trench coats and tailored silhouettes. Keep color either tonal with your outerwear or intentionally contrasted so it reads as part of the look, not an afterthought.
What’s the best way to care for wool and cashmere accessories?
Always check the care label first, then treat wool and cashmere as you would knitwear. Spot clean where possible, use a gentle fabric comb to remove light pilling, and air pieces flat between wears. Store scarves and gloves folded rather than hung to protect the fibers and keep their shape.
